Get Rid of Dirt

You’ll first want to clean the windows so that the dirt, debris, leaves, and other things of this nature are removed. You don’t want anything like the aforementioned in your windowsills or in any other part of your windows. You can use a small brush or a handheld vacuum to get rid of anything that can prevent your windows from getting a good seal.

 

Check Weather Stripping

What sort of condition is your weather stripping in? If it’s in good shape, great! But if it’s not in good shape, you’ll want to replace it. If the weather stripping has seen better days, you can bet that the cold air will seep inside of your dwelling, and this will cause your furnace to operate less efficiently. Weather stripping is a relatively inexpensive product, so make sure you assess all your windows and then replace the weather stripping as necessary. While you’re at it, use caulking around your windows if there’s a need for it. The weather stripping and the caulking will go a long way toward keeping your home warmer during the long winter months.

Assess Surfaces

How are your window surfaces – like the frames – doing? If you have wood windows that are showing signs of wear and tear, you should repair them before winter comes. Do you see any signs of moisture or water damage? You’ll want to be proactive when you find such problems. The staff at a replacement window store will be able to help you remedy any problems.
